4. Always wear sunglasses in summer The fact that UV rays can cause severe damage to your eyes is well-known. It is also important to remember that even if your contact lenses provide UV protection, you still need to wear sunglasses for complete protection. 5. Ensure proper lighting whenever you read Eye strain may be caused by lighting that is too poor or too bright. Measures such as decreasing the brightness of your monitor and drawing the curtains / blinds on bright days go a long way in decreasing strain.
6. Give your eyes a break during long stretches of computer use Close your eyes for 10 seconds after every hour of computer use before opening them. You may also try to focus on an object located at a distance to exercise your eyes. Try this and you will experience the difference these 10 seconds make to your eyes!
7. Take proper care of your contact lenses If you wear contact lenses, make sure you rinse them before and after wearing them to avoid any eye related infection.

9. Avoid wearing contact lenses for more than 12 hours Wearing contacts for long stretches may cause permanent damage and extreme discomfort.
